Your brain doesn’t function in isolation.
Mental health is a whole body experience, and symptoms like anxiety, panic, and fatigue, may have roots in:
• Gut health
• Hormonal imbalance
• Thyroid dysfunction
• Chronic inflammation
• Unprocessed trauma

Ever notice how one negative thought can spiral into a whole cycle?
A single belief like “I’m not enough” can trigger painful emotions, lead to avoidance or self doubt, and eventually seem to prove that very thought true. Over time, these loops shape how we experience the world, even when they no longer serve us.

Therapy helps us interrupt the pattern. Not by forcing positivity, but by exploring what’s underneath. Where our beliefs come from, how they’ve protected us, and how we can choose differently.

When we understand our patterns, we gain the power to change them.

You might be in withdrawal and not even know it.

Withdrawal isn’t only about hard drugs. It can show up after stopping anything your body or brain has grown used to (caffeine, cannabis, alcohol, prescription meds, ni****ne, or even social media and sugar).

Your body is incredibly adaptive, and it notices when something changes.
